We've reviewed the lost texts and learned about the original Zybourne Clock. Now we explore its legacy and transformation from an object of mockery to an affectionate and relatable artifact of what the internet used to be.


Extra special thanks to Fuego Fish from the Something Awful forums, who worked on The Zybourne Clock, for being my source on this episode. You can check out his fiction and ongoing work at http://plunderpress.com/


This week we are joined by video game expert Jeremy Kaplowitz, co-host of the Quorators podcast and co-founder of the video game satire site Hard Drive.
